Kutibari - Phiringia, Kandhamal
Kutibari is a village situated in the Phiringia tehsil of Kandhamal district, Odisha. It is located approximately 8 km from the tehsil headquarters in Phiringia and around 35 km from the district headquarters in Phulbani. Ratanga serves as the Gram Panchayat for Kutibari village.
As per Census 2011, the village code of Kutibari is 416410. The village covers a total geographical area of 73 hectares and falls under the 762011 pincode. Phulabani is the nearest town, located about 34 km away.
Kutibari village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Sarpanch serving as the elected head. For political representation, the village falls under the Phulbani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ency and the Kandhamal Lok Sabha (Parliamentary) constituency.
Population of Kutibari
As per Census 2011, Kutibari village has a total population of 276 people, consisting of 151 males and 125 females. The village has 69 households and a sex ratio of 827 females per 1,000 males. There are 32 children in the 0–6 years age group. The village has 174 literate and 102 illiterate residents. Additionally, 56 people belong to Scheduled Caste (SC) communities and 21 to Scheduled Tribe (ST) communities.
Detailed gender-wise population figures for Kutibari are given below:
| Category | Total | Male | Female |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Population | 276 | 151 | 125 |
| Child Population (0–6 yrs) | 32 | 19 | 13 |
| Scheduled Castes (SC) | 56 | 28 | 28 |
| Scheduled Tribes (ST) | 21 | 12 | 9 |
| Literate Population | 174 | 109 | 65 |
| Illiterate Population | 102 | 42 | 60 |

Transport and Connectivity of Kutibari
Public transport in the Kutibari is mainly available through shared auto-rickshaws. The nearest railway station is located within >10 km of Kutibari.
| Connectivity | Status | Nearest Availability |
|---|---|---|
| Public Bus Service | No | Available within <5 km |
| Private Bus Service | No | Available within <5 km |
| Railway Station | No | Available within >10 km |
In addition to basic transport facilities, distances and travel times help define overall connectivity. The road distance from Phulabani to Kutibari is about 34 km, with a usual travel time of around 1-1.25 hours. Similarly, the road distance from Phulbani to Kutibari is about 35 km, with the usual travel time around 1-1.25 hours. Actual travel time may vary depending on road conditions and mode of transport.
